I did a test piece of some birch trees.
Im a bit worried that it will not survive for long at my local game club as I guess it is a bit fragile so im thinking on having it at home and only bring it on special occasions.
Its made out of twigs glued to a base and spraypainted black and then white. After I had painted it I sprayed it with some varnishing and glued on the flock.
